Cheech Marin became famous as perhaps the most famous comedic stoner duo in history – Cheech & Chong. IGN had the chance to speak to Marin today at the TCA (Television Critics Association) press tour, where he was promoting his new Lifetime movie, The Miracle of Dommatina, in which he plays a priest. But don't let the fact that Marin is playing a Man of God in a Lifetime project fool you – he still hasn't forgotten his roots. In fact, while on stage, he revealed that he and Tommy Chong were mulling over a new project that he hoped to begin soon, joking, "Time's a' wasting!"

Later in the day, I asked Marin if he could clarify what sort of new project he was speaking of, and he told me, "We'd like to go out and do some live dates. It would be fun." Of course if Cheech & Chong reunite, fans will quickly wonder if a new movie might result. When I asked if that was a possibility, Marin replied with a smile, "Well, you never know!"

Marin explained that he and Chong have recently, "been writing and seeing what we can remember." He noted that when it came to reintroducing their alter egos to a modern audience, "I think they'll be perceived pretty well, because most of the bits we did in our stage show were really classic bits. They didn't have any time period associated with them."

Referencing Marin's Lifetime movie, I noted that the last time audiences saw him playing a priest was in the midst of the purposely over-the-top violence in the fake trailer for Machete, which Robert Rodriguez created for Grindhouse. At the time, Rodriguez said he would love to make Machete into an actual film, perhaps as a straight-to-DVD project. If that project comes to fruition, Rodriguez should have no trouble getting frequent collaborator Marin back, as the actor told me, "I would love for him to do that! I'm just waiting for him to call me. Call me Robert! Let's do it, man!"
